What is the spark plug gap on 2004 Mitsubishi Lancer 2.4 engine?

The spark plug gap on 2004 Mitsubishi Lancer 2.4 engine should be set between .7 and .8 mm. A new spark plug may be purchased for this vehicle at any auto parts retailer.


What is the spark plug gap on a Mitsubishi lancer 1998 coup gli?

The spark plug gap on a 1998 Mitsubishi Lancer Coupe Gil should be set between .039 and .043 inches. This gap specification was set by the manufacturer.

What is the spark plug gap setting on a 1996 Mitzi lancer MR 1600 mivec?

The spark plug gap for a 1996 Mitsubishi Lancer MR 1600 mivec should be set between 1.0 and 1.1 mm. A new spark plug will not need to be gapped as they are gapped at the factory.
